Synopsis
Agata and Bartek had just returned from living and working in Barcelona ​​where Agata, a specialist in marketing, had been delegated by the company for which she worked. They repaired their small Warsaw apartment, bought new furniture and out of curiosity began to look through the advertisements of property for sale. They dreamed of something bigger, preferably with a piece of garden. However, for the time being they just wanted to relax in their own apartment, having lived in rented spaces in Spain.

Unexpectedly, an open plan apartment came to their attention. It had ceilings more than three meters high, an unusual arrangement of rooms and warm wooden floors. There was no garden and it was completely different to what they had been imagining but it was exactly what they needed. It had a thoroughly modern, yet homely feel thanks to the warm wooden additions so they snapped it up.
